The PIC16F1613T-I/ST is a microcontroller belonging to the PIC16 family of 8-bit microcontrollers produced by Microchip Technology. The PIC16F1613T-I/ST operates as a control unit in embedded systems, executing programmed instructions to interact with external devices and sensors. It interfaces with various peripherals and sensors through its I/O pins and communication interfaces, enabling the control and monitoring of external systems.
In conclusion, the PIC16F1613T-I/ST is a versatile 8-bit microcontroller suitable for a wide range of embedded control applications. Its low power consumption, integrated peripherals, and versatile I/O make it a compelling choice for designers seeking an efficient and cost-effective solution for their projects.
